Overview Table

CategoryDetails
Full NameRohan Sushil Kunnummal
BornKannur, Kerala, India
Batting StyleRight-handed
Primary RoleTop-order batsman
BowlingOccasional off-spin
Major TeamsKerala, India A, Duleep Trophy teams, domestic leagues
StrengthsAggressive intent, fearless stroke play, fast starts, timing-based power, strong off-side play
Known ForAttacking opening style, high strike rate in red-ball cricket, breakthrough Duleep Trophy performances
CharacterCalm, hardworking, internally driven, technically stable despite aggression
X-FactorAbility to dominate bowling attacks from the first ball, rare attacking opener from Kerala
Long-Term PotentialFuture all-format India prospect, cornerstone of Kerala’s batting for the next decade

Rohan Kunnummal The Kerala Cricket Ecosystem and Rising Through the Ranks

Kerala’s cricketing structure has improved in recent decades, producing names like Sanju Samson, Tinu Yohannan, Basil Thampi, and Sandeep Warrier. But for a specialist batsman, particularly an opener, the path is challenging. Limited turf wickets, high humidity affecting fitness, and tight competition within zones push players to elevate their standards.

Rohan Kunnummal Technical Blueprint — The Foundation of Aggression

Although Rohan is celebrated for his aggressive batting, his technique is rooted in classical fundamentals. His aggression is not born from slogging; it is the result of solid basics executed with intent.

1. Stance and Setup

He begins with a balanced, neutral stance. His head remains still, eyes level, enabling him to track the ball early.

2. Footwork

Rohan’s footwork is quick and aligned. Against pace, he moves decisively. Against spin, he uses his feet to reach the pitch of the ball.

3. Bat Swing

His bat swing is straight, with a slightly extended follow-through, generating timing-based power.

4. Off-Side Play

He is particularly strong through cover, point, and backward point. His cuts and drives on the up are signature strokes.

5. Leg-Side Control

He flicks and whips the ball beautifully through midwicket. His wrists generate surprising power.

6. Response to Length

He reads length quickly, enabling him to play attacking shots with minimal risk.

7. Seam and Spin Adaptability

Against seam, he plays close to his body. Against spin, he sweeps, dances down, and uses angles effectively.

8. Controlled Innovation

He is willing to play modern strokes but does not rely on them.

Rohan is not just a hitter. He is a technically sound batsman capable of adapting across formats.
